Lentils, … The lentil (Lens culinaris or Lens esculenta) is an edible legume.It is an annual plant known for its lens-shaped seeds.It is about 40 cm (16 in) tall, and the seeds grow in pods, usually with two seeds in each.As a food crop, the majority of world production comes from Canada and India, producing 58% combined of the world total. A quick check of the nutrition data on some labels shows that green lentils are particularly high in protein (13.5 grams per cooked portion), while the black type score well in fiber (6.3 grams per cooked portion).
